Cruz Hewitt wins first ATP match in Washington

Entities: Lleyton Hewitt · Cruz Hewitt · Washington, D.C. · Stefanos Tsitsipas · Zachary Svajda

Overview

Following his runner‑up finish at the Wimbledon boys’ singles in July 2026, 17‑year‑old Australian Cruz Hewitt qualified for the ATP 500 Washington Open, becoming the first Australian teenager to reach a main draw at that level. After a qualifying win over Dusan Lajović, he was drawn against fellow Australian Marcos Giron.

In his main‑draw debut, Hewitt defeated Giron 6‑3, 6‑4 in 74 minutes, securing his first ATP Tour victory and becoming the youngest Washington champion since Kei Nishikori in 2007. The win lifted his ranking from around 612 into the mid‑300s and earned roughly $52,000 and 75 points. He will face the winner of the Alex de Minaur – Stefanos Tsitsipas match in the second round.

The breakthrough adds to his rapid rise from junior success toward the senior circuit, echoing the legacy of his father, former world No. 1 Lleyton Hewitt.
